What to Look For When Buying

The most feature in pill poppers for aggressive cats is the tip design, which directly impacts both safety and during medication administration. Soft silicone tips prevent injury to sensitive mouth tissues while providing the grip strength needed to secure pills during a cat's resistance efforts. Look for tips that can accommodate your cat's typical medication sizes, generally ranging from 0.15 to 0.4 inches for most feline prescriptions.

Construction quality becomes when dealing with aggressive cats who may bite or claw at the device. Medical-grade materials resist damage from sharp teeth while maintaining structural integrity under stress. The connection between the tip and main body should be secure enough to prevent separation during use, as loose tips can become choking hazards.

Ergonomic design features impact your ability control during challenging medication sessions. Look for handles that secure grip even when wet or during sudden cat movements. Some models include textured grips or finger guards that prevent slipping during moments.

Affects long-term usability and hygiene, for multi-pet households or facilities. Smooth surfaces without deep crevices allow sanitization between uses, while dishwasher-safe construction simplifies maintenance routines.

How Pill Poppers Work

Pill poppers for aggressive cats function by creating a controlled delivery system that bypasses natural defensive behaviors while safe medication placement. The soft tip holds the pill securely while allowing precise positioning behind the cat's tongue, where natural swallowing reflexes take over once the medication is released.

The mechanism involves gentle restraint combined with quick, confident delivery that minimizes the time a cat has to resist or escape. Unlike forcing pills by hand, these tools maintain distance between your fingers and sharp teeth while providing better control over pill placement. The plunger system allows measured pressure that releases pills at the moment.

Successful operation depends on proper technique rather than force, with the goal being cooperation rather than domination. The cat's natural anatomy works in your favor when pills are placed correctly behind the tongue, triggering automatic swallowing responses that complete the medication process.

Timing becomes with aggressive cats, as extended restraint increases stress and resistance. Effective pill poppers enable quick, efficient delivery that reduces handling time while maintaining safety for both cat and caregiver.

Common Problems and Real Solutions

The most with pill poppers for aggressive cats involves improper tip placement, which can cause gagging, pill rejection, or increased resistance during future medication attempts. The solution lies in positioning the tip behind the tongue rather than forcing it deep the throat, allowing natural swallowing mechanics to work effectively.

Pill size compatibility problems often arise when medications don't fit securely in the tip, leading to pills falling out during administration or getting stuck in the delivery mechanism. Many modern pill poppers accommodate sizes, but large or unusually shaped medications may require tip modification or alternative approaches.

Cat conditioning represents a challenge, as many cats learn to associate the sight of pill poppers with negative experiences. Success strategies include gradual introduction without medication, positive reinforcement with treats, and maintaining calm, confident energy during administration sessions.

Tip durability issues can compromise safety and effectiveness, with cats who bite aggressively or when tools are used frequently. Regular inspection for cracks, tears, or wear continued safety, while having backup tips available prevents interruption of medication schedules.

Improper restraint techniques often escalate aggression rather than facilitating cooperation. Gentle but secure positioning, avoiding excessive force, and working with a partner when can transform medication time from a battle a manageable routine.

Multi-Cat or Special Situation Tips

To pill poppers for aggressive cats in requires careful attention to hygiene and individual cat needs. cleaning between cats prevents cross-contamination while separate tools for each cat eliminate the need for mid-session sanitization during time-sensitive medication schedules.

Senior cats with arthritis or dental issues may require modified techniques that account for increased sensitivity and reduced mobility. Gentler pressure, slower movements, and extra patience often yield better results than standard approaches designed for healthy adult cats.

Kittens present unique challenges smaller size and different behavioral patterns. Scaled-down tools or careful tip selection proper fit while avoiding injury to developing mouth structures. Early positive experiences with pill administration can prevent future aggressive behaviors.
